First-aid measures

Emergency measure - Inhalation: Remove patient to fresh air. Symptomatic treatment.

Emergency measure - Eyes: Rinse with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es. Seek

medical attention if irritation persists.

Emergency measure - Skin: Wash immediately with plenty of soap and water.

If irritation persists seek medical attention.

Emergency measure - Ingestion: Symptomatic treatment. Seek medical attention.

Fire-fighting measures

Recommended extinguishing agent: Carbon dioxide, foam, dry powder or water mist may be used.

Water is not recommended.

Product arising from burning: Products of combustion may contain oxides of carbon.

Product determined by test: N

Protective equipment: A self-contained breathing apparatus should be worn.

Accidental release measures

Emergency measures in case of spillage: Wear suitable protective clothing (see 2.3.1).

Contain and absorb spill using sand or another inert

material. Transfer to labelled containers and dispose in

accordance with national/local regulations. Wash spill site

with water. Avoid discharge to watercourses.

Handling and storage

Handling: Observe the usual precautions for handling organic

chemicals. Ensure adequate ventilation. Avoid inhalation and

contact with skin and eyes.

Protective clothing (Standard EN368), eye/face protection

(Standard prEN166) and rubber gloves (Standard prEN374)

should be worn. Respiratory protection such as an organic

vapour mask conforming to Standard EN405ffA1 is necessary.

Storage: Store in tightly closed containers.

Keep away from heat sources, extremes of temperature and

oxidising agents.

Packaging of the substance and or preparation: Tightly closed aluminium containers.

Disposal considerations

Industry - Possibility of recovery/recycling: Recovery for recycling is not possible.

Industry - Possibility of neutralisation: No chemical treatment is available to neutralise the known

health and environmental effects of the substance.

Industry - Possibility of destruction: controlled discharge: Disposal at a controlled landfill site is possible. (A650)

Industry - Possibility of destruction - incineration: Recommended method of destruction. Incinerate at a suitable

facility. Stack gases should be scrubbed.

Industry - Possibility of destruction - water purification: Not permitted.

Public at large - Possibility of recovery/recycling: The substance will only enter the public domain incorporated

into formulations.

Recovery from preparations for reuse is not possible.

Public at large - Possibility of neutralisation: No chemical treatment is available to neutralise the known

health and environmental effects of the substance.

Public at large - Possibility of destruction - others: The substance will only enter the public domain as part of

cosmetic and household preparations which can be disposed of

as for normal domestic waste.
